2024年6月5日发(作者:)
iframe 标签传参数
使用iframe标签传参数
在网页开发中,iframe标签常用于嵌入其他网页或文档,实现页面
的嵌套和交互。通过使用iframe标签传递参数,可以实现不同页面
之间的数据传递和共享。
下面我将通过一个简单的示例来说明如何使用iframe标签传递参数。
我们在父页面上创建一个iframe标签,并设置好宽度和高度:
```
```
接下来,我们在父页面的JavaScript代码中动态设置iframe的
src属性,并传递参数:
```
var iframe = mentById("myIframe");
= "?param1=value1¶m2=value2";
```
在子页面中,我们可以通过JavaScript获取父页面传
递的参数,并进行相应的处理:
```
var params = ing(1).split("&");
var paramObj = {};
for (var i = 0; i < ; i++) {
var pair = params[i].split("=");
paramObj[pair[0]] = pair[1];
}
// 使用传递的参数进行相应的操作
(1);
(2);
```
通过以上代码,我们可以在子页面中获取到父页面传递的参数,并
进行相应的操作。
需要注意的是,参数的传递需要进行URL编码,以确保参数值的正
确传递和解析。可以使用encodeURIComponent()函数对参数进行编
码,使用decodeURIComponent()函数对参数进行解码。
在实际应用中,我们可以根据具体需求,通过iframe标签传递各种
类型的参数,实现页面之间的数据交互和共享。通过合理的设计和
使用,可以提升网页的交互性和用户体验。
希望以上内容对您有所帮助。如果您有任何疑问,请随时向我提问。
发布评论